PayPal and sports betting explained

PayPal is an e-wallet service provider that facilitates online payments between platforms through transfers. Since its launch in 1998, the money-transfer giant has gained over 300 million users worldwide. Today, thousands of online merchants and customers use a well-known and trusted payment option.

The e-commerce company offers safe, reliable, and fast transactions making it an ideal payment option for bettors and sportsbooks. With the method, bettors can deposit funds into their betting account and collect winnings without disclosing any financial details. Plus, it offers exceptional security features that allow it to build a loyal customer base.

When it comes to PayPal and sports betting bonuses, it’s worth noting that you may be excluded from welcome bonuses like risk-free bets, deposit matches, and free spins. This is a popular disadvantage among most e-wallet services like Neteller and Skrill because some bettors take advantage of the anonymity behind these service providers. As a result, sportsbooks have noticed a trend of bonus abuse in this regard. So, checking the site’s terms and conditions is in your best interests.

How to withdraw from a WI betting site with PayPal

Unlike payment options like MasterCard, PayPal offers bettors the option to make both deposits and withdrawals. With the payment service, you can conveniently transfer your winnings within 24 hours. Other payment methods typically process withdrawals within 1 to 5 business days, so this makes PayPal a speedy option.

When it comes to withdrawals, always remember that these are slightly different from deposits. This is because your account first needs to be eligible for a withdrawal before you can proceed to initiate the payout. Things like wagering requirements and site processing time are essential in determining the transaction speed and whether you’ll qualify for a withdrawal. Therefore, it’s best to thoroughly read the terms and conditions before initiating the withdrawal.

Is PayPal a safe option on Wisconsin betting sites?

Yes, PayPal is a safe option when using it on Wisconsin betting sites. Safety remains one of PayPal's unique features that many bettors enjoy, thanks to an encrypted service that helps keep your bank information and financial details secure. Additionally, sportsbooks also offer privacy policies and security features of their own to ensure that every bettor's details are kept private.

Does PayPal have fees when used on WI sportsbooks?

No. Usually, when used on a sportsbook in Wisconsin, PayPal won't charge a fee. In most cases, sportsbooks will have banking pages that detail everything relating to a payment service. This is where you'll find concluding information on what the sportsbook will charge bettors for using PayPal. Nevertheless, PayPal will charge 2.9% when you have to deposit funds using your debit card or credit card.
